where can i watch dragon ball z
You can legally watch Dragon Ball Z today mainly on paid streaming platforms, plus digital purchase services, though exact options vary by country and change over time.
Main streaming options
- Crunchyroll – The most reliable home for Dragon Ball Z in many regions, with the series available via standard subscription rather than per‑episode purchase.
- Crunchyroll channel via Prime Video – In some regions you can access Dragon Ball Z by adding the Crunchyroll channel inside Amazon’s Prime Video app.
- The Roku Channel – In regions where The Roku Channel operates, Dragon Ball Z is available to stream there with the required subscription.
If you just want “press play and binge Z,” a Crunchyroll subscription is often the simplest route right now.
Buy or rent digitally
If you prefer owning episodes instead of subscribing:
- Amazon Video / Prime Video Store – Lets you buy Dragon Ball Z episodes or seasons digitally; episodes typically appear as HD purchases inside Prime Video.
- Fandango at Home (formerly Vudu) – Offers Dragon Ball Z for digital purchase as well.
These services are good if you only care about a few arcs (for example, just the Saiyan and Frieza sagas) and don’t want a long‑term subscription.
